The Action Congressof Nigeria, ACN, has warned of surreptitious moves by the leadership of the Senate and by extension, the ruling People’s Democratic Party, PDP, to declare vacant the seat of Senator Ajayi Boroffice representing Ondo North Senatorial District who recently decamped from the Labour Party to ACN.

A statement issued in Lagos on Wednesday by ACN National Publicity Secretary Alhaji Lai Mohammed, said under the nation’s constitution and laws it is only the courts that can make the declaration that a legislator’s seat has become vacant and warned the David Mark-led Senate to desist from its arm twisting tactics to gain undue political advantage.

According to the party, “Senator Boroffice has violated no provision of the 1999 Constitution as amended or any extant law when it made the decision to dump the Labour Party for the Action Congress of Nigeria and this latest attempt to arm twist and declare Senator Boroffice’s seat vacant came only after months of overt and covert pressure to make him to join the ruling People’s Democratic Party failed.”

The Action Congress while assuring David Mark and his co travelers that it will resist his jack boot manipulations also called on all its members in the Senate to resist and fight this act of illegality and barefaced provocation aimed at destabilising the party ahead of the 20 October Ondo state governorship election.

The party recalled that since the dawn of democratic government some thirteen years ago, the nation has witnessed opposition senators defecting to the ruling PDP without any threat of sanction and vowed to fight within the ambits of the law to ensure that what is good for the goose is also good for the gander.
